U.S. airline CEOs were encouraged by passenger traffic during the week’s Memorial Day holiday, which marks the unofficial start of summer for the United States. But their European counterparts are less optimistic, and are hoping to avoid a second “lost” summer. Meanwhile, rumblings of mergers and acquisitions has caused no end of drama in Brazil.
